Key Segmentation Insights in the Spindle Rebuild Market
A deeper analysis of the spindle rebuild service market reveals multifaceted segmentation that reflects both the diversity of industrial applications and the breadth of service offerings. The segmentation based on industry application covers sectors such as Aerospace, Automotive, and Manufacturing, with Aerospace itself examining segments like Commercial Aviation, Defense, and General Aviation. Within Automotive, the nuances between the Aftermarket and Original Equipment Manufacturer sides create tailored service needs, while Manufacturing delves into segments such as Food Processing, Pharmaceutical, and Textile industries.
In parallel, segmentation based on spindle type brings to light the distinctions among Belt Driven Spindle, Electric Spindle, and Gear Driven Spindle, further dissected into sub-categories like Multi Belt systems, High Frequency and Manual Mount spindles, along with Double Gear and Single Gear configurations. A similar level of detail is observed when the market is segmented by service type, which contrasts the differing needs of Maintenance, Rebuilding, and Repair. Maintenance services are typically split into areas such as Lubrication Service and Routine Checkups, while Rebuilding services address both complete and partial rebuild processes. In addition, Repair services have nuanced applications including both In-Shop and On-Site methodologies.
The segmentation based on technology type – distinguishing CNC Spindle with sub-categories like Horizontal and Vertical orientations, and Manual Spindle aligning with Lathe-Centric and Milling-Centric approaches – underscores the technological spectrum that drives service expectations. Furthermore, segmentation based on end-user industry, which includes Automotive Repair Shops, Large Scale Manufacturing Units as well as Machine Shops, accentuates the critical differences between Dealer Service Centers and Independent Workshops or between OEM Units and SME Units. Finally, segmentation driven by material type, comparing Aluminum in its Alloyed and Pure forms with Composite and Steel – itself analyzed across Carbon and Stainless types – adds another layer of complexity to the service market, ensuring every customer need is addressed in a comprehensive manner.

Company Landscape and Market Move Drivers
The competitive landscape is defined by a host of specialized companies that have built their reputation on excellence in spindle rebuild services. Industry leaders such as A&A Machine & Spindle Co., Inc. and Columbus Spindle Repair, Inc. have long been recognized for their technical proficiency and commitment to quality. Meanwhile, companies like Koyo Machinery USA and Northland Tool & Electronics Inc. are at the forefront of innovation, continually adapting to evolving industry requirements.
Other influential players, including Precision Drive Systems, LLC (PDS) and Setco Spindle Repair, exhibit strong market positioning through their focus on comprehensive repair and maintenance solutions. The involvement of prominent firms like SKF USA Inc. further underlines the importance of brand trust and technological expertise. Additionally, service providers such as SPS Spindle Parts and Service, LLC, Superior Spindle Service, and TriMAS Corporation contribute to a competitive environment where customer-centric approaches and continuous improvement drive market growth.
